GODWIN EZEAKA A journalist, researcher, writer, and author, Godwin has published four books on Rev. Fr. Raymond Ifeanyi Ezeonu. His most recent work, The Broken Bread: The Life and Legacy of Rev. Fr. Raymond Ifeanyi Ezeonu (2026), stands as the definitive biography of the revered missionary. Through rigorous scholarship and sustained advocacy, he bridges the gap between historic missionary heritage and contemporary social reform—preserving institutional memory while advancing actionable humanitarian values. He serves as Secretary of the Board of Trustees of the Twins and Multiple Births Care Foundation (TAMBCF), a platform through which he promotes the protection, dignity, and social inclusion of twins and multiple births within Igbo society and beyond.
